 Baklava (Low Fat Low Cal Version)

    1/2 lb Shelled pistachio nuts,           1/2 lb Filo dough
           -ground                           1/2 c  Low-calorie margarine,
      3 tb Sugar                                    -melted
    3/4 ts Ground cinnamon                          Rose Water Syrup
  1 1/2 tb Rose water                               Whole cloves,optional

  This rich-tasting baklava contains half the amount of sugar and a
  fraction of the fat you would normally use, thanks to reduced fats,
  sugar, and nuts. The results will fool anyone.

  1. Combine pistacho nuts, sugar, cinnamon and rose water in small
  bowl. Using half of filo sheets (cover remaining with plastic wrap to
  prevent from drying out), place 3 sheets in bottom of lightly greased
  13x9" baking sheet. Brush with some of margarine. Sprinkle evenly
  with nut mixture. Place remaining sheets over nut filling, brushing
  after every third sheet and top sheet. 2. Cut baklava at 1-1/2"
  intervals diagonally to form pattern of about 35 diamond shapes. Bake
  at 400'F. 25 minutes or until golden. Place on wire rack to cool.
  Drizzle Rose Water Syrup evenly over top and allow to soak several
  hours. Stud each diamond-shape with whole clove.

  Each piece baklava with syrup contains about: 85 calories; 32mg
  sodium; 0 cholesterol; 5 grams fat; 9 grams carbohydrate; 2 grams
  protein; trace fiber.
